The effect of aqueous extract of Acacia albida stem bark was investigated in Wistar albino rats infected with Trypanosoma evansi. The extract showed highest reduction in parasitemia at the dose of 600 mg/kg body weight (bw). A dose of 300 mg/kg bw improved packed cell volume the most by 14.35%. The group treated with 150 and 600 mg/kg bw of the extract showed significant decrease (P < 0.05) in alanine transaminase and aspartate transaminase levels which were lower than those of the group treated with diminazene aceturate. The group treated with 150 mg/kg bw of the extract showed the least urea, albumin and protein level and lowest relative organ weight. There was a significant difference (P < 0.05) in the levels of catalase and Thiobarbituric acid reactive substances in liver and kidney of the animals in the infected-untreated group and the extracts-treated groups. The results of this study show that the extracts of A. albida have antitrypanosomal activity against T. evansi infection.
